电脑编程为什么用0和1
-
电脑编程使用0和1是因为计算机中的所有信息都是以二进制形式存储和处理的。二进制是一种由0和1组成的数字系统,与我们平常使用的十进制不同。
首先,我们需要明白计算机是由许多电子元件组成的。这些电子元件可以通过开关的状态来表示不同的信息。一个开关可以有两种状态,即打开和关闭,分别用1和0来表示。
其次,计算机中的所有数据,无论是文字、图像、音频还是视频,都可以转化为二进制形式进行存储和处理。这是因为计算机内部的处理器和存储器都是由许多由电子元件组成的电路构成的,它们只能理解和处理二进制数据。
在计算机中,每个二进制位被称为一个比特(bit)。8个比特可以组成一个字节(byte),一个字节可以表示256种不同的状态。通过使用不同数量的比特和字节,计算机可以表示和处理更多的数据。
使用0和1进行编程有以下几个优势:
-
简单明确:二进制只有两个状态,使得信息的表示和处理更加清晰和简单。每个位上的0和1可以分别表示开和关,真和假,使得逻辑判断和运算更加直观。
-
可靠性高:二进制信号在电子元件中传输和处理时,不容易受到干扰和误差的影响。相比于其他进制,二进制的稳定性更高,可以更可靠地保证信息的传输和处理的准确性。
-
兼容性强:使用二进制进行编程,可以使得计算机在不同的硬件平台和操作系统上运行。无论是基于英特尔架构的个人电脑还是基于ARM架构的移动设备,都可以使用相同的二进制代码进行编程和运行。
总之,计算机编程使用0和1是基于计算机内部电子元件的特性和二进制数表示的简洁性。通过使用二进制进行编程,可以实现高效、可靠和跨平台的计算机系统。
1年前 -
-
电脑编程使用0和1作为编码方式的原因是因为计算机是基于二进制系统工作的。
-
二进制系统:计算机内部使用的是二进制系统,即只有两个数字0和1。这是因为计算机的硬件是由许多电子开关组成的,这些开关只能处于两个状态:开或者关,对应于0和1。使用二进制系统可以简化计算机内部电路的设计和操作。
-
数字表示:使用0和1来表示数字是一种简洁有效的方式。在二进制系统中,每个数字位只有两个状态:0或者1。通过组合不同的数字位,可以表示任意大小的数字。这种简单的表示方式可以方便地进行数学运算和逻辑操作。
-
存储数据:计算机中的数据都是以二进制形式存储的。无论是数字、文字还是图像、声音等,都可以通过将其转换为二进制编码来存储在计算机的内存或磁盘中。使用0和1作为编码方式可以最大限度地减少存储空间的占用。
-
逻辑运算:计算机中的逻辑运算是通过比特位(二进制位)的组合来实现的。使用0和1作为编码方式可以方便地表示逻辑运算的真值表,例如AND、OR、NOT等。这样可以在计算机中实现复杂的逻辑操作,用于控制程序的执行流程。
-
网络通信:在计算机网络中,数据传输也是以二进制形式进行的。通过使用0和1作为编码方式,可以方便地将数据转换为数字信号进行传输,例如在以太网中使用的是以太网协议。这种方式可以确保数据的准确传输和解析。
总之,使用0和1作为编程的基础是因为计算机是基于二进制系统工作的,这种编码方式简洁有效,方便进行数学运算、逻辑操作、数据存储和网络通信。
1年前 -
-
电脑编程使用二进制的0和1是因为计算机是以数字电路为基础的,而数字电路只能处理两个状态,通常用0表示关闭或低电平,用1表示打开或高电平。这种二进制的表示方法使得计算机能够进行高效的数值计算和逻辑运算。
在计算机中,信息和数据都以二进制形式表示。一个二进制位(bit)可以表示0或1,而多个二进制位组合在一起可以表示更大的数值和更复杂的数据。比如,一个字节(byte)由8个二进制位组成,可以表示0~255之间的数值。
使用0和1作为编程语言中的基本单元,有以下几个原因:
-
简单明确:0和1是最基本的数字,使用它们作为编程语言的基础可以简化计算机的设计和实现。所有的逻辑运算和数值计算都可以通过0和1的组合来完成。
-
高效可靠:二进制表示法在数字电路中非常高效和可靠。由于只有两个状态,信号的传输和处理非常稳定,减少了误差和噪声的影响。
-
可扩展性:二进制表示法可以很方便地扩展到更大的数字和更复杂的数据类型。通过增加二进制位数,可以表示更大的数值范围。同时,通过组合多个二进制位,可以表示更复杂的数据结构,如字符、图像、音频等。
-
兼容性:二进制表示法是计算机系统中的通用语言,不受特定硬件或软件平台的限制。它可以在不同的计算机系统之间进行数据交换和通信。
在编程中,0和1被用来表示逻辑值,比如布尔类型的真和假。通过逻辑运算,可以实现复杂的判断和控制流程。此外,0和1还可以表示数字,通过数值运算,可以进行加减乘除等数学运算。总之,使用0和1作为编程语言的基础,可以实现高效、可靠和可扩展的计算机系统。
1年前 -